APPROXIMATION AND INTERPOLATION IN THE SPACE OF CONTINUOUS FUNCTIONS VANISHING AT INFINITY

  • Kashimot, Marcia (Departamento de Matematica e Computacao Universidade Federal de Itajuba)
  • Received : 2010.06.01
  • Published : 2011.09.30

Abstract

We establish a result concerning simultaneous approximation and interpolation from certain uniformly dense subsets of the space of vector-valued continuous functions vanishing at infinity on locally compact Hausdorff spaces.
